Home
last modified time | relevance | path

Searched refs:langInfo (Results 1 – 6 of 6) sorted by relevance

/base/telephony/sms_mms/utils/
Dtext_coder.h38 …Utf8(uint8_t *dest, int maxLength, const uint8_t *src, int srcLength, const MsgLangInfo &langInfo);
56 …Ucs2(uint8_t *dest, int maxLength, const uint8_t *src, int srcLength, const MsgLangInfo &langInfo);
57 …int EscapeTurkishLockingToUcs2(const uint8_t *src, int srcLen, const MsgLangInfo &langInfo, uint16…
58 …int EscapePortuLockingToUcs2(const uint8_t *src, int srcLen, const MsgLangInfo &langInfo, uint16_t…
59 …int EscapeGsm7bitToUcs2(const uint8_t *src, int srcLen, const MsgLangInfo &langInfo, uint16_t &res…
60 uint16_t EscapeToUcs2(const uint8_t srcText, const MsgLangInfo &langInfo);
Dtext_coder.cpp392 uint8_t *dest, int maxLength, const uint8_t *src, int srcLength, const MsgLangInfo &langInfo) in Gsm7bitToUtf8() argument
412 …2(reinterpret_cast<uint8_t *>(pUcs2Text), maxUcs2Length * sizeof(WCHAR), src, srcLength, langInfo); in Gsm7bitToUtf8()
767 uint8_t *dest, int maxLength, const uint8_t *src, int srcLength, const MsgLangInfo &langInfo) in Gsm7bitToUcs2() argument
783 if (langInfo.bLockingShift) { in Gsm7bitToUcs2()
784 TELEPHONY_LOGI("National Language Locking Shift [%{public}d]", langInfo.lockingLang); in Gsm7bitToUcs2()
785 if (langInfo.lockingLang == MSG_ID_TURKISH_LANG) { in Gsm7bitToUcs2()
786 i += EscapeTurkishLockingToUcs2(&src[i], (srcLength - i), langInfo, result); in Gsm7bitToUcs2()
789 } else if (langInfo.lockingLang == MSG_ID_PORTUGUESE_LANG) { in Gsm7bitToUcs2()
790 i += EscapePortuLockingToUcs2(&src[i], (srcLength - i), langInfo, result); in Gsm7bitToUcs2()
795 i += EscapeGsm7bitToUcs2(&src[i], (srcLength - i), langInfo, result); in Gsm7bitToUcs2()
[all …]
/base/telephony/sms_mms/services/sms/
Dsms_base_message.cpp364 MsgLangInfo langInfo = { in ConvertSpiltToUtf8() local
367 langInfo.bSingleShift = false; in ConvertSpiltToUtf8()
368 langInfo.bLockingShift = false; in ConvertSpiltToUtf8()
370 buff, MAX_MSG_TEXT_LEN, split.encodeData.data(), split.encodeData.size(), langInfo); in ConvertSpiltToUtf8()
Dgsm_cb_codec.cpp197 MsgLangInfo langInfo; in ConvertToUTF8() local
201 …odeSize = TextCoder::Instance().Gsm7bitToUtf8(outBuf, sizeof(outBuf), src, raw.length(), langInfo); in ConvertToUTF8()
/base/telephony/sms_mms/services/sms/gsm/
Dgsm_sms_param_decode.cpp80 MsgLangInfo langInfo; in DecodeAddressAlphaNum() local
81 langInfo.bSingleShift = false; in DecodeAddressAlphaNum()
82 langInfo.bLockingShift = false; in DecodeAddressAlphaNum()
84 …einterpret_cast<uint8_t *>(resultNum->address), MAX_ADDRESS_LEN, tmresultNum, tmplength, langInfo); in DecodeAddressAlphaNum()
Dgsm_sms_message.cpp573 MsgLangInfo langInfo; in ConvertUserPartData() local
576 langInfo.bSingleShift = true; in ConvertUserPartData()
577 langInfo.singleLang = langId; in ConvertUserPartData()
580 …, MAX_MSG_TEXT_LEN, reinterpret_cast<uint8_t *>(smsUserData_.data), smsUserData_.length, langInfo); in ConvertUserPartData()